BROOKLINE, Mass. - In a Saturday afternoon CAA match up at Parsons Field, the Northeastern men's soccer team (0-2-2, 0-1-0 CAA) fell to the Campbell Camels (4-0-1, 1-0-0 CAA) by a 1-0 score.
- The Huskies put up a tough battle in the opening half as the score remained at a draw for majority of action.
- Campbell's goal came in the 39th minute to give the Camels the 1-0 lead.
- Northeastern took over possession in the second half, tallying seven shots on goal.
- Both the Huskies and the Camels recorded two corners in the contests second half.
- Goaltender Tobias Jahn collected five saves on the day.
The Huskies return to non-conference play this coming Tuesday, September 10, when they host Merrimack at 6pm on FloFC.
